Family Portrait Style: Go Bold

This month we get bright and colorful with our Family Portrait Style series. I’ve done some fun posts featuring autumn colors of warm browns, casual blues, and harvest reds. But it’s time to get bold with color and dress your family to impress.

In the image below I used bright canary yellow and slate grey as my core colors. Then I added a little bubble gum pink for a pop of brightness. Throw in neutral greys and you’ve got a bright, sunny family ready to smile all day long. See? Creating your own family portrait style is as easy as one, two, three.

The family below went bold with pink, purple, and brown. Plum purple made for a bold statement as a core color, and is nicely balanced by a grounding earth brown. Pops of pink and blue make everyone want to smile, and are rounded out by cream neutrals. Notice that you don’t always have to match your landscape. Bold colors make you the center of attention in the best way.
